Shown above is just 1 of 4 angles availible. Satellite images from N. S. E. and West are available from Microsoft Live Search Maps. Very handy for checking what the house backs to (i.e. golf course, train tracks, busy street).

Wake County iMaps will let you see the exact lot dimensions with measurements
Zillow.com shows satellite images with home value estimates on each roof.
Google Streets has coverage for most of suburban Cary and Raleigh. Its usefull for takeing a virtual drive down a neighborhood street.
